Why Sine Wave Inverter Housings Matter in Renewable Energy
Pure sine wave inverters form the backbone of modern solar systems, converting DC power to stable AC electricity. Their protective housings must withstand:
- Extreme temperatures (-20°C to 55°C operational range)
- Salt spray corrosion (critical for coastal installations)
- IP65-rated dust/water resistance
- EMI/RFI shielding compliance
